Donegal hold off Monaghan to reach Ulster semi-final

Donegal 0-23 Monaghan 0-21

Donegal made hard work but eventually prevailed in the Ulster quarter-final against a battling Monaghan in St Tiernach’s Park, Clones.

Donegal stormed ahead in the opening stages and established an 0-10 to 0-4 lead, with Michael Murphy kicking a two point free and Peadar Mogan (0-3) and Dáire Ó Baoill (0-2) adding to that.

Ciaran Thompson kicked a two pointer and added two more Jim McGuinness’ side led by 0-14 to 0-8 at the break.

But Monaghan hit back to make it a one point game in the second half and while Donegal got ahead by five again, the Farney men brought it back to two points as Dessie Ward kicked a two pointer with 90 seconds to go.

He tried his luck again a minute later outside the arc but it fell just wide as Donegal held on.
